Whelp, just ordered my Tarptent Cloudburst 3! :mrgreen:

Turns out Henry missed my first email, hence the longish delay, but was very helpful once I got in contact with him. Now he's off hiking again but someone else at Tarptent has been answering my inquiries. Ordering for this particular tent is not as streamlined as for the others, i.e. you can't get many of the accessories for it yet (ground sheet, liner). Also there doesn't seem to be a simple way to request seam sealing -- you have to contact them directly whereas I would think it'd be much easier to add it is as purchasable option, but these are minor things. All in all a very good company to deal with so far and the tent itself looks awesome. Can't wait. Will post updates when I receive it.

Postby Joomy » Thu 19 Sep, 2013 10:03 pm

Ah yeah I left that bit out. Well delivery was $50 for the tent + extra pole, which is expensive but about what you'd expect. Total with the extra pole shipped was USD382 or about AUD420 after Visa's cut. Not super cheap but quite competitive I reckon, especially considering I was comparing it with a Hilleberg Anjan 3. Weirdly enough the embedded USPS software wanted to charge me $85 if I added a few metres of cord, so I left that out. Ill probably go through Zpacks to get some extra cord and pegs (and maybe tyvek) because their shipping costs work out to be much more reasonable.

Postby Franco » Fri 20 Sep, 2013 7:17 am

Weirdly enough the embedded USPS software wanted to charge me $85 if I added a few metres of cord

Sorry about that, it is a problem with the software.
The system is guessing the extra volume needed as well as the extra weight, it isn't good enough to work it out correctly.
Just send an E Mail to info@tarptent and they will adjust the charge manually.
